Special Stage Forums banner
1-1 of 1 Results
  1. New Member Forum - Introduce Yourself
    Hi All, have been on special stage before reading whatever comes up and checking out cars for sale in the classifieds, I'm volunteering next weekend in Wellsboro for STPR and am very excited to jump in to the sport with both feet! any info / cautions / cool stories - I'd love to hear em! Also...
1-1 of 1 Results